Updating windscreen washer jets (D2)
The long discussion about upgrading D3 jets to either triple of fan variants made me think about the limitations of the D2 windscreen washer jets.
Has anyone ever tried to upgrade/improve them? Years ago I upgraded my old (long gone) Ford Focus with fan jets which were much better, and thinking about them today I realised the originals were very similar in design to the D2 ones. A quick rummage later and I found the originals I had replaced (why do I still have them? :Confused: ) and headed off to the garage to look at my spare scuttle cover. The Ford jets click straight in to the rectangular mounting holes on the D2 scuttle panel. :D They are a bit narrower but the fit is good and the direction/angle looks plausible when I check against my car. +++ Need to look at the wiring for the heated jets but that's going to be easy to transplant if the connectors are different. :cool: Off now to search online for Fan jets for Ford Focus MkIII (or is it MkII?). |

I'll probably just plug them in unheated to start with to check fitment/alignment etc.
That all should be pretty simple, though you need to remove the scuttle panel (and wiper arms first) to unclip the jets and swap the pipes over. The Ford ones have a tiny lug on to align precisely so a corresponding tiny notch may be needed in the scuttle panel. Probably won't be here for a few weeks; slow boat from China! :ROFL: Quote:
